Reaching New Audiences: Effective Music Distribution for Independent Artists

Navigating the contemporary music landscape demands a strategic approach to distribution that empowers independent artists to expand their following. Gone are the days when relying solely on conventional outlets was sufficient. Today's dynamic music ecosystem encourages a multifaceted plan that leverages both online and offline channels.

A well-defined distribution plan begins with identifying your specific audience. Understanding their listening habits, preferred platforms, and engagement styles is vital for tailoring your campaign to resonate effectively.

Investigate a range of digital services, including streaming giants like Spotify, Apple Music, and Amazon Music, as well as niche platforms that align in specific genres or demographics.

Market your music across social media, connecting with fans and building a loyal community. Collaborate with other artists, website tastemakers, and industry figures to broaden your reach.

In conclusion, effective music distribution for independent artists requires a flexible approach that embraces the ever-evolving landscape. By identifying your audience, utilizing diverse platforms, and cultivating a strong online network, you can successfully reach new fans.
